B2324-HEADLAMP WASHER MOTOR CONTROL CIRCUIT HIGH

For a complete wiring diagram, refer to the Wiring Information Electrical Diagrams.

- When Monitored:
With the Headlamp Washers activated.

- Set Condition:
When the Totally Integrated Power Module (TIPM) detects an high condition.





1. INTERMITTENT CONDITION
1. Turn the ignition on.
2. With the scan tool, clear all DTCs.
3. Turn the Headlamp Washers on.
4. With the scan tool, read DTCs.

Does the scan tool display active: B2324-HEADLAMP WASHER MOTOR CONTROL CIRCUIT HIGH?

Yes

- Go To 2

No

- The condition that caused this symptom is currently not present. Check for an intermittent condition by inspecting the related wiring harness for chafed, pierced, pinched, and partially broken wires. Also, inspect the related connectors for broken, bent, pushed out, spread, corroded, or contaminated terminals. Repair as necessary.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

2. CHECK HEADLAMP WASHER RELAY
1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Remove the Headlamp Washer relay.
3. Turn the ignition on.
4. Turn the Headlamp Washers on.
5. With the scan tool, read DTCs.

Does the scan tool display active: B2324-HEADLAMP WASHER MOTOR CONTROL CIRCUIT HIGH?

Yes

- Go To 3

No

- Go To 5

3. (W24) HEADLAMP WASHER RELAY CONTROL CIRCUIT OPEN




1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Disconnect the TIPM C1 harness connector.
3. Measure the resistance of the (W24) Headlamp Washer Relay Control circuit between the Headlamp Washer Relay connector and the TIPM C1 harness connector.

Is the resistance below 10.0 Ohms?

Yes

- Go To 4

No

- Repair the (W24) Headlamp Washer Relay Control circuit for an open.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

4. (W24) HEADLAMP WASHER RELAY CONTROL CIRCUIT SHORTED TO VOLTAGE




1. Turn the ignition on.
2. Measure for voltage on the (W24) Headlamp Washer Relay Control circuit.

Is the voltage above 10.0 volts?

Yes

- Repair the (W24) Headlamp Washer Relay Control circuit for a short to voltage.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Replace the Totally Integrated Power Module (TIPM).
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

5. HEADLAMP WASHER RELAY
1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Replace the Headlamp Washer relay with a known good relay.
3. Turn the ignition on.
4. Turn the Headlamp Washers on.
5. With the scan tool, read DTCs.

Does the scan tool display active: B2324-HEADLAMP WASHER MOTOR CONTROL CIRCUIT HIGH?

Yes

- Go To 6

No

- Test Complete.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

6. (W23) HEADLAMP WASHER MOTOR CONTROL CIRCUIT OPEN
1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Remove the Headlamp Washer relay.
3. Disconnect the Headlamp Washer Motor harness connector.
4. Measure the resistance of the (W23) Headlamp Washer Motor Control circuit at the Headlamp Washer Motor harness connector and the Headlamp Washer Relay connector.

Is the resistance below 10.0 Ohms?

Yes

- Go To 7

No

- Repair the (W23) Headlamp Washer Motor Control circuit for an open.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

7. (W23) HEADLAMP WASHER MOTOR CONTROL CIRCUIT SHORTED TO VOLTAGE
1. Turn the ignition on.
2. Measure for voltage on the (W23) Headlamp Washer Motor Control circuit.

Is the voltage above 10.0 volts?

Yes

- Repair the (W23) Headlamp Washer Motor Control circuit for a short to voltage.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Replace the Headlamp Washer Motor.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.
